Javascript 从jquery UI可调整大小元素中删除句柄图像
如何删除可调整大小元素的默认Javascript 从jquery UI可调整大小元素中删除句柄图像,javascript,jquery,jquery-ui,Javascript,Jquery,Jquery Ui,如何删除可调整大小元素的默认东南(se)句柄图像,并添加我自己的图像?在具有类ui可调整大小的div内部,您需要将div的背景图像替换为类ui图标小对角线se 您可以执行以下操作: $(".ui-icon-gripsmall-diagonal-se").css("background-image", "url(someImage.png)") 您有两个选择: 您可以覆盖底部提到的ui可调整大小句柄或ui可调整大小se 您可以更改图像文件“ui-icons_2222_256x240.png”,这
东南(se)
句柄图像,并添加我自己的图像?在具有类ui可调整大小
的div内部,您需要将div的背景图像替换为类ui图标小对角线se
您可以执行以下操作:
$(".ui-icon-gripsmall-diagonal-se").css("background-image", "url(someImage.png)")
您有两个选择:
ui可调整大小句柄
或ui可调整大小se
我总是在.css文件中这样做
.ui-dialog .ui-resizable-se {
background-image: url("");
}
而且它一直有效:)这篇文章中的说明对我很有用: 使用此css:
.ui-widget-content .ui-icon.ui-icon-gripsmall-diagonal-se {
width: 32px;
height: 32px;
background: url(<insert your image url here>) left top no-repeat;
}
.ui小部件内容.ui-icon.ui-icon-gripsmall-diagonal-se{
宽度:32px;
高度:32px;
背景:url()左上角不重复;
}
我永久性地移除了调整大小手柄,改变了css,如下所示:
<style>
.ui-icon, .ui-widget-content .ui-icon
{
background-image : none;
}
</style>
.ui图标、.ui小部件内容.ui图标
{
背景图像:无;
}
它适合我。您还可以在resizeable()中指定所需的句柄,例如仅用于“e”句柄
您也可以通过“创建”选项解决此问题:
$('#element').resizable({
create: function(event, ui) {
$('.ui-icon-gripsmall-diagonal-se').remove();
}
})
我希望这对你有用:
.ui-resizable-handle {
z-index: auto !important;
background-image: url('');
}
如果你需要完全移除手柄图标,只需将背景图像设置为“无”
.ui-resizable-handle {
background-image: none;
}
只需重写这些类。这些是默认情况下应用的类:
ui可调整大小的句柄ui可调整大小的se ui图标ui图标gripsmall diagonal se
对于我来说,在v1.11.4版中是:.ui图标{背景图像:url(“”)!重要;}
问题是如何更改特定图标,在您的情况下,您隐藏了所有ui.icon。这很有魅力!
.ui-resizable-handle {
background-image: none;
}
$('.ui-icon-gripsmall-diagonal-se').css("background-image", "url('')");